- [ ] Step 7: Archive cold storage buckets (Glacierline tier). Confirm both ceremony witnesses are present, verify bucket manifests match the Oxbow ledger, then seal the archive key shares. Plugin authors may observe but not handle shares. Once sealed, the archive index itself is encrypted and can only be reopened with the passphrase below.

vault phrase of badup-hahig = tamael-aldael-kelmir-istael-fenok-istwyn-tamius-jorath-oliion

A few notes for reviewers: the templating engine never touches donor payment data — receipts are rendered from a sanitized snapshot, and outbound mail goes through a single audited relay. If you spot anything sketchy (template injection, header smuggling, over-broad queue permissions), please don't open a public issue. We triage security reports privately within two business days, usually faster. Send your findings, with repro steps if possible, straight to us.

escalation mailbox, yajeg-bageg: quenax.olidor@lumiccorp.internal

Runbook 7.3 — Account recovery for the Wayfinder autocomplete widget.

If the service account backing the Wayfinder suggestion index is locked out, first confirm the lockout in the auth audit log, then disable the widget's write path so partial suggestions are not indexed. Re-enroll the account through the Bramleigh admin console and restore the cached geodata snapshot. The final re-enrollment prompt asks for the shared recovery passphrase, which is recorded below.

vault phrase of tajop-haduf = holath-brivan-wenax

# Runbook: Hunting leaked file descriptors in Quillgate

When the `fd_open` gauge climbs steadily between deploys, suspect a leak rather than load. First confirm on a single pod: exec in and count entries under `/proc/1/fd`, noting how many are sockets in CLOSE_WAIT versus regular files. Capture two snapshots ten minutes apart before restarting anything — we need the delta for the postmortem. Reproduce locally with the Marbury load harness, which requires the service running with the following configuration values.

settings of yagep-bajog:
[istdor]
port = 4000
region = south-2
host = istdor.qorvelcorp.internal
timeout_ms = 5000
retries = 5